Output 175e51c27c6c94c6fe341f0fe48c40470a75b22fcd3384ec8f1b30f2fc6358d5:5

value
69960000
script pubkey
OP_0 OP_PUSHBYTES_20 e586a3c89dd6621a359c5c5b03d8949b0e3b2a9f
address
bc1qukr28jya6e3p5dvut3ds8ky5nv8rk25l524jjw
transaction
175e51c27c6c94c6fe341f0fe48c40470a75b22fcd3384ec8f1b30f2fc6358d5
confirmations
170626
spent
true